What is a Self-Emptying Vacuum?
A self-emptying vacuum is a robotic cleaner equipped with an automated disposal system. After performing its cleaning tasks, the vacuum go back to its docking station, where it clears its dirt bin into a larger collection bag or container. This feature allows users to prevent the trouble of frequent emptying, making home cleaning less of a chore.

Self Emptying Vacuum-emptying vacuums run through a combination of robotic innovation and a tactically created docking station:

How often do I need to empty the docking station?
Depending upon use and the design's capacity, the docking station usually requires to be emptied every 1-3 months.
Are self-emptying vacuums quiet?
Most designs run quietly, but noise levels may differ. Makers often supply decibel ratings for reference.
Will a self-emptying vacuum work on my carpets?
Yes, a lot of self-emptying vacuums are designed to handle numerous surface area types, including carpets and difficult floorings.
Can I manage my self-emptying vacuum from another location?
Yes, lots of self-emptying vacuums featured app connection, enabling you to start, stop, and schedule cleaning sessions from another location.
Are they suitable for family pet hair?
Absolutely! Many designs are particularly designed to take on family pet hair and dander, with features that boost their efficiency on this type of debris.
